Bitcoin Cash (BCH): The Scalable Sibling
Bitcoin Cash emerged from a Bitcoin hard fork specifically to address scalability concerns. Its primary innovation involves significantly larger block sizes, enabling faster transaction processing and lower fees compared to Bitcoin.
While BCH maintains Bitcoin's core principles of decentralization and security, its practical improvements make it more suitable for everyday transactions. The network processes payments more efficiently, positioning it as a medium of exchange rather than primarily a store of value.
Investment considerations for BCH include its established position among Bitcoin forks and its focus on practical usability. However, potential investors should note that its market performance has sometimes lagged behind other major cryptocurrencies during bull markets.
Cardano (ADA): The Research-Driven Platform
Cardano distinguishes itself through its scientific philosophy and methodical development approach. This third-generation blockchain employs a peer-reviewed development process, ensuring thorough scrutiny of all protocol changes before implementation.
The platform utilizes a proof-of-stake consensus mechanism called Ouroboros, which is significantly more energy-efficient than Bitcoin's proof-of-work system. Cardano's architecture separates computation layers, enhancing security and allowing for more flexible smart contract capabilities.
Cardano's potential lies in its ambitious roadmap and strong academic foundations. Its focus on sustainability, interoperability, and scalability addresses many limitations present in earlier blockchain generations.
Ethereum (ETH): The Smart Contract Pioneer
Ethereum represents the most direct competitor to Bitcoin in terms of market capitalization and developer mindshare. While Bitcoin primarily functions as digital gold, Ethereum offers a comprehensive ecosystem for decentralized applications, smart contracts, and token creation.
The network's transition to Ethereum 2.0 with proof-of-stake consensus aims to address scalability concerns while reducing energy consumption. This upgrade could significantly enhance transaction throughput and lower gas fees, strengthening Ethereum's position as the leading decentralized application platform.
Ethereum's vast developer community and established infrastructure create powerful network effects. The platform hosts most decentralized finance protocols and non-fungible token projects, solidifying its central role in the blockchain ecosystem.
Algorand (ALGO): The Pure Proof-of-Stake Solution
Algorand offers a unique consensus mechanism designed to achieve true decentralization without compromising speed or security. Its pure proof-of-stake protocol randomly selects validators for each block, preventing mining centralization and ensuring fair participation.
The network boasts impressive transaction speeds comparable to traditional payment processors while maintaining blockchain's security benefits. Algorand's permissionless architecture and low transaction costs make it attractive for various applications, including financial services and asset tokenization.
Algorand's approach to solving the blockchain trilemma—balancing decentralization, security, and scalability—positions it as a strong contender for enterprise adoption and mainstream applications.
Litecoin (LTC): The Silver to Bitcoin's Gold
Often described as digital silver to Bitcoin's digital gold, Litecoin offers faster block generation times and a different hashing algorithm than Bitcoin. These technical differences result in quicker transaction confirmations and lower fees.
Litecoin has historically served as a testing ground for Bitcoin improvements, with features like Segregated Witness and Lightning Network implementation often debuting on Litecoin before Bitcoin. This symbiotic relationship demonstrates Litecoin's continued relevance within the cryptocurrency ecosystem.
The cryptocurrency maintains strong liquidity and widespread exchange support, making it easily accessible for investors and users seeking Bitcoin exposure with enhanced transactional capabilities.
Dogecoin (DOGE): The Community-Powered Phenomenon
Originally created as a joke, Dogecoin has evolved into a serious cryptocurrency with an incredibly dedicated community. Its low transaction fees and fast confirmation times make it practical for microtransactions and tipping content creators online.
Dogecoin's inflationary supply model distinguishes it from Bitcoin's fixed supply, potentially making it more suitable as a medium of exchange rather than a store of value. The active community frequently organizes promotional campaigns and fundraising efforts, demonstrating the power of grassroots cryptocurrency movements.
While its technical innovations may be limited compared to other projects, Dogecoin's cultural impact and community engagement represent a different approach to cryptocurrency value creation.
Binance Coin (BNB): The Exchange Ecosystem Token
Binance Coin has evolved far beyond its original purpose as a exchange utility token. The Binance Smart Chain launch created a vibrant ecosystem for decentralized applications, offering compatibility with Ethereum Virtual Machine while providing lower transaction costs.
BNB's utility spans trading fee discounts, participation in token sales, payment processing, and governance rights within the Binance ecosystem. This multifaceted utility creates consistent demand beyond mere speculation.
The Binance ecosystem's rapid growth and expanding services provide strong fundamental support for BNB's value proposition. Its integration across multiple blockchain applications demonstrates how exchange tokens can evolve into comprehensive ecosystem drivers.
